Around the year 1800, philosophers, writers, and artists in Germany began to propagate a new vision of the world they described as "romantic". The term covered a range of ideas: that nature was informed with the divine spirit and that the individual human imagination could immerse itself in the universal fabric; but also that the creative mind, being profoundly solitary, would yearn for harmony between man and nature--Page 4 of cover
